A native Georgian, Curtis' attraction to produce began as a small
boy, as he followed his Grandfather Curtis through the garden. His interest grew during
high school, when he worked at the Conyers, Georgia A&P Market. "I was supposed
to be in the grocery department," he recalls, "but I hung out in produce because
that's where all the action was." His enthusiasm soon became a career. In 1988, Curtis returned to Georgia to begin Aiken's Family Produce, Inc., a wholesale and retail supplier of produce for clients which ranged from the Rockdale County School System to the TV series In the Heat of the Night and the feature film Glory. Curtis' career as a television personality and author began in 1988. Currently. He resides in Novato, California and Conyers, Georgia and is the father of two young sons, Curtis, Jr. and Cole. These days, Curtis Aikens is most often recognized as the host of his popular TV Food Network Show. PICK OF THE DAY, which showcases his talent as a meat-free chef. In order to educated viewers on the art of selecting, storing and using fresh produce, Curtis takes them shopping in his own market. Specially constructed in the TV Food Networks' New York studios. He has been with the Network since its inception, previously as the host of From My Garden, Meals Without Meat, and Food IN A Flash.
